PROCCL Clinique de l’Espoir et de l’Esperance
PROCCL Clinique de l’Espoir et de l’Esperance is a clinic in Estuaire Province, Gabon which is located on Cité OCTRA_Owendo_1er arrondissement. PROCCL Clinique de l’Espoir et de l’Esperance is situated nearby to the stadium Stade Idriss Ngari, as well as near the military installation Camp de Gendarmerie Colonel TOULEKIMA.| Tap on a place to explore it |

Stade Idriss Ngari
Stadium
Stade Idriss Ngari is a multi-use stadium in Owendo, Gabon. It is currently used mostly for football matches, on club level by Association Sportive des Commerçants Mounana of the Gabon Championnat National D1. The stadium has a capacity of 5,000 spectators.
